Frequently Asked Questions about Fleming Island
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fleming Island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fleming Island ranges from $850 to $2,519 with an average monthly rent of $1,462.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fleming Island c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fleming Island range from $1,050 to $3,223.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,613.
How expensive are Fleming Island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 31 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fleming Island on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,110 to $4,672 - averaging $1,857 for the location.
